BLADE ARCUS Rebellion from Shining is a tactical role-playing game that combines elements of strategy, exploration, and character customization. The game takes place in a fantasy world where players assume the role of a commander tasked with leading a team of warriors to victory against an evil force threatening the land.

: Players select two characters to form a team. While you primarily control one character, you can call on your partner for "Link Attacks" and "Support Skills," or switch active characters between rounds.
